Hi, I needed a function to get the fontname by a pointer to the ttf file.
Here is the solution:
#include <WinAPIEx.au3>
#include <Memory.au3>
Global $hFile, $lFile, $tBuffer, $pBuffer, $iFile
Global $sFile = FileOpenDialog("Choose Truetype Font", @ScriptDir, "Truetype Font (*.ttf)", 3)
If @error Then Exit 1
$hFile = _WinAPI_CreateFile($sFile, 2, 2)
If $hFile = 0 Then Exit 2
$lFile = FileGetSize($sFile)
$tBuffer = DllStructCreate("byte[" & $lFile + 1 & "]")
$pBuffer = D